Southeast Los Angeles, Los Angeles, CA Guía Local

¿Cuánto cuesta alquilar un apartamento en Southeast Los Angeles?
Dormitorios | Precio Promedio | Más barato | Más caro |
---|---|---|---|
Apartamentos Estudio en Southeast Los Angeles | $2,309 | $695 | $10,000+ |
Apartamentos 1 Dormitorios en Southeast Los Angeles | $2,847 | $500 | $9,390 |
Apartamentos 2 Dormitorios en Southeast Los Angeles | $3,779 | $1,000 | $10,000+ |
Apartamentos 3 Dormitorios en Southeast Los Angeles | $6,133 | $1,869 | $10,000+ |
Apartamentos 4 Dormitorios en Southeast Los Angeles | $4,123 | $1,028 | $10,000+ |
Apartamentos 5 Dormitorios en Southeast Los Angeles | $4,271 | $3,650 | $5,500 |
Apartamentos 6 Dormitorios en Southeast Los Angeles | $4,916 | $3,800 | $6,999 |
